Fuel

Wood stoves can burn a variety of fuels, including dry wood, as well as manufactured solid fuels, such as briquettes or fire logs. These cleaner burning alternatives are healthier and more sustainable than traditional house coal or wet wood. However, they release smoke and harmful gases and require regular maintenance to keep them working at their best.

Make sure you read the manufacturer's guidelines prior to purchasing or using any kind of fuel. Make sure it is the correct fuel for your stove. Unsuitable fuels could damage your stove or chimney, wood heater stove leading to expensive repairs and invalidating your warranty. It's illegal to use unapproved fuel, especially in smoke control zones. Check for the 'Ready to Burn logo, which indicates that the fuel meets the smoke emission and sulphur limits and can be legally sold for domestic use. The logo is usually placed alongside the price and details about the brand or on the packaging.

The fuels that are suitable for use should be seasoned (stored and then split for a few months before use) or kiln dried to reduce the amount of moisture which improves heat output and combustion efficiency. The kind of wood you choose must also be suited to your heating needs. Softwoods like pine and spruce provide good value for money, however, hardwoods such as oak or beech generate more hot embers, and they do so over a longer time. Fruitwoods such as apple and cherry can not only be used to heat the home, but also add a pleasant aroma.

Design

The design of wood stoves is a crucial aspect to consider when considering them as a primary or supplementary source of heat. Smoke and carbon monoxide are unwanted byproducts that can be harmful to health and the environment. The key to minimizing the emission of these gases is to ensure proper operation and a careful design.

Modern wood stoves are designed to be more environmentally conscious than traditional models. All EPA certified stoves must meet strict energy efficiency and emission regulations to maximize the amount of heat generated. Look for an iron EPA certification mark on the back of the stove, or check out the EPA's current database to see the stove is certified. Visit local hearth product retailers who are knowledgeable about the performance capabilities of their inventory is also a great way to learn more about wood burning fires stoves and what size and capacity is the Best wood burning stoves fit for your home.

Controlling the flow of air through the stove is a crucial element of EPA emission regulations. The firebox of the stove is surrounded by fireproof walls, and there are air vents within these walls to allow for controlled airflow. Controlling airflow is crucial to ensure that the combustion is efficient and emissions are reduced.

A lot of modern stoves come with baffles that prolong the amount of time that the fire burns and reduces the amount of smoke and harmful gases. Certain wood stoves include catalytic converters to cut down on NOx emissions. This kind of system is a little more expensive and is typically only used in high-end wood stoves.

Stoves utilize different air control systems to regulate the flow of air. Most wood stoves use the basic air supply that is passive, which requires that the owner (you), operate the stove correctly to achieve maximum efficiency. Some stoves feature active air sources that are controlled by sensors. These sensors monitor the combustion process, and adjust the air supply when needed.

Heat output

A lot of wood stoves advertise an output of heat at the peak in BTUs. This is a mistake because the actual output of a wood-burning stove is dependent on many variables such as the size of the room and how well insulated it is.

The climate of the region also plays a role in heating demands. To maintain comfort in colder areas, you need stoves that have higher BTU ratings.

The type of wood and the frequency with which you refuel your fireplace are additional factors that affect the production of heat. Dry, seasoned contemporary wood burners produces more heat than freshly cut and wet logs. The stove fan can also help circulate the warmth produced by the wood stove into the room, rather than having the hot air rise up.

It is crucial to remember that the maximum output of a wood heater stove should not be reached frequently since continuous high fire can cause damage to the stove's internals and can cause carbon monoxide to escape into the home.

The performance of a stove can be enhanced by regular refueling. Make sure that the log isn't too large and is placed on the glowing embers, so it does not touch the glass or the walls of the stove. You can add smaller logs more frequently instead of taking too long between additions.

High efficiency stoves are designed to provide a higher amount of heat output using the same amount of fuel, by providing pre-heated combustion air as well as other design features. These stoves emit less carbon monoxide, toxins, and smoke than older models.

A few people also decide to install a back boiler stove as part of their heating system. The heat generated by a wood-burning stove is used to heat water for central heating systems or a hot water tank. This lets the heat be distributed in the house. This is an efficient and cost-effective method of heating the home. However the installation process could take quite a long time. This method requires a separate flue and the additional energy required to run a back boiler will raise the operating costs of wood stoves.

Safety

Fireplaces and wood stoves are a convenient and attractive method of heating your home. They are not without risks. A fire can cause carpets or furniture to catch fire and a fireplace that is hot can cause structural damage to your home. The dangers can be reduced by maintaining and using a wood-burning fireplace.

Wood-burning stoves should be inspected and maintained regularly to keep them secure and in good condition. This includes checking the chimney and flue at least two times every year for signs of rust or wear, and cleaning them. The chimney must be inspected for creosote about halfway through the season. It is extremely flammable, and can cause a fire in the chimney.

When buying a wood-burning fireplace make sure you choose one that has been certified by Underwriters Laboratories or another recognized testing laboratory. This ensures that the stove complies with federal safety standards and is designed to ventilate properly. You should also inspect the hinges, legs and grates on a stove to make sure they are in good condition and are securely fastened to the floor.

If you decide to put in a wood stove in your cabin, be sure that the floor underneath it is non-combustible and reinforced. It is also possible to lay a layer of non-combustible floor tile over the flooring that is in place, especially in the case of an old mobile home that has combustible floors.

Burn only seasoned, dry hardwoods. Wet and green woods produces excessive smoke and creosote. This flammable byproduct can build within your chimney, releasing harmful chemicals. Don't burn trash, cardboard, newspaper or other combustibles in your wood stove, since they can release dangerous fumes, and they may not fully burn.

Do not "over fire" your wood stove -that is, to generate a larger flame than the stove is able to handle. Over-fired stoves can lead to flames escaping from the combustion chamber, causing damage to the stove, chimney connector and the chimney itself, as well as burning other combustible material in your home. It is also crucial to ensure that the fire is completely snuffed out before leaving your cabin or going to sleep. Also, you must have functioning carbon monoxide and smoke alarms in your house.
